Discovering Unique Storytelling in Indie Games

One of the most exciting aspects of story rich indie games is their ability to experiment with unconventional storytelling techniques. Many indie developers are pushing the boundaries of interactive narrative, incorporating elements of visual novels, branching dialogues, and environmental storytelling to create truly immersive experiences. This often leads to more personal and intimate stories that resonate with players on a deeper level. Consider games like Disco Elysium, which features a complex skill system that directly impacts dialogue options and the player's ability to interact with the world, or What Remains of Edith Finch, which tells a series of interconnected stories through unique gameplay mechanics tailored to each family member's experience. These games demonstrate how indie developers are redefining what it means to tell a story in a video game.

Emotionally Resonant Experiences in Indie Games

Beyond innovative storytelling techniques, indie games excel at creating emotionally resonant experiences. Often, these games explore difficult or sensitive topics with empathy and nuance, providing players with opportunities to reflect on their own lives and perspectives. Games like Gris, a visually stunning platformer that deals with grief and loss, or Celeste, a challenging platformer that tackles anxiety and self-doubt, offer powerful and moving experiences that stay with players long after the credits roll. By focusing on character development and emotional depth, these indie games create a connection with players that is often missing in more mainstream titles.

Hidden Gems: Underrated Narrative Indie Games

While some narrative indie games achieve widespread recognition, many others remain hidden gems, waiting to be discovered. These underrated titles often offer unique and compelling stories that deserve a wider audience. Games like Little Misfortune, a dark and whimsical adventure game with a surprisingly poignant story, or Night in the Woods, a character-driven exploration game that delves into themes of mental health and small-town life, are examples of indie games that offer memorable and thought-provoking experiences. Seeking out these hidden gems can lead to discovering truly special and unforgettable stories.

Showcasing Exceptional Narrative Design in Indie Games

Exceptional narrative design is a hallmark of many standout indie games. These games often feature well-developed characters, intricate plotlines, and meaningful choices that impact the story's outcome. Consider games like Return of the Obra Dinn, a mystery game with a unique art style and a compelling narrative that unfolds through careful observation and deduction, or Kentucky Route Zero, an episodic adventure game that explores themes of Americana and magical realism through a series of interconnected stories. These games demonstrate the power of thoughtful narrative design to create truly immersive and unforgettable gaming experiences. The attention to detail in crafting these narratives is what sets them apart and makes them so captivating.

How Indie Games Tackle Complex Themes

One of the strengths of indie games with compelling narratives is their willingness to tackle complex and often sensitive themes. Unlike many mainstream games that shy away from difficult topics, indie developers often use their games as a platform to explore issues such as mental health, grief, social injustice, and political unrest. By addressing these themes with empathy and nuance, indie games can spark important conversations and promote greater understanding and awareness. Games like Hellblade: Senua's Sacrifice, which explores the impact of psychosis on the protagonist's perception of reality, or Papers, Please, which confronts players with the moral dilemmas faced by border control officers in a dystopian regime, are examples of indie games that tackle challenging topics in a thought-provoking and impactful way.
